🔥 Course Title:
“Ignite Awareness, Prevent Disaster: A 1-Day Fire Safety Essentials Training”
📘 Brief Description of the Course:
This intensive 1-day training equips participants with essential knowledge and skills to prevent, detect, and respond to fire-related emergencies in the workplace and built environments. The course demystifies fire science, introduces legal safety obligations, and teaches life-saving response techniques—from evacuation procedures to fire extinguisher use. It is designed for both technical and non-technical personnel to build a proactive safety culture and reduce fire risks in any organization.
🎯 Learning Objectives:
By the end of the training, participants will be able to:
- Explain the basic science behind fire ignition, spread, and suppression.
- Identify common fire hazards in workplaces and facilities.
- Apply fire prevention strategies to mitigate risks.
- Understand roles and responsibilities during fire emergencies.
- Respond correctly during a fire using evacuation plans and fire safety equipment.
- Comply with Philippine Fire Code (RA 9514) and workplace fire safety standards.
📚 Course Content (1 Day | 8 Hours):
🕘 Session 1: Understanding Fire and Its Hazards
- The Fire Triangle and Tetrahedron
- Types and Classes of Fire
- Common Workplace Fire Hazards
- Real-Life Case Studies (Philippines context)
🕘 Session 2: Fire Prevention and Control Measures
- Fire Risk Assessment Basics
- Housekeeping and Hazard Elimination
- Electrical, Chemical, and Combustion Controls
- Passive and Active Fire Protection Systems
🕛 Session 3: Fire Safety Laws and Standards
- RA 9514 – Fire Code of the Philippines
- DOLE Guidelines on Workplace Fire Safety
- Role of the Bureau of Fire Protection (BFP)
- Employer and Employee Responsibilities
🕐 Session 4: Emergency Preparedness and Evacuation
- Fire Emergency Plan Components
- Evacuation Procedures and Assembly Points
- Roles of Fire Marshals and Safety Officers
- Fire Drills: Frequency and Implementation
🕒 Session 5: Fire Extinguishers and Response Tactics
- Types and Uses of Fire Extinguishers (A, B, C, D, K)
- PASS Technique: Pull, Aim, Squeeze, Sweep
- Limitations and Safe Use
- When to Fight vs. When to Evacuate
🕓 Session 6: Fire Safety Culture
- Building Fire-Safe Habits at Work and Home
- Leadership Role in Fire Safety Culture
